Pes 2013 Data Pack 5.0 And Patch 1.04

Data Pack 5.0 and Patch 1.04 represent Konami’s iterative approach to keeping PES 2013 current and stable mid-season—DP5.0 focused on cosmetic accuracy and roster updates, while 1.04 targeted gameplay stability and online reliability. Together they made PES 2013 feel more complete and provided a better foundation for both casual players and the modding community.
